Output 833ddc22316e6dae79f81bb6e43606f154657e6ff88278b6aae5490712e7ccde:19

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c45a04eaa6da9247fbdce55974f994810a661fc1 OP_EQUALVERIFY OP_CHECKSIG
address
1JuDHF5pVj4i6nkjDu1FsW8a1Uh136tGw5
transaction
833ddc22316e6dae79f81bb6e43606f154657e6ff88278b6aae5490712e7ccde
spent
true